Mike Little

Profile

Mike Little is a Canadian politician currently serving as the mayor of the District of North Vancouver, a position he has held since 2018. Before his election as mayor, he served on the District Council from 2005 to 2014 and worked in the private sector for his family's transportation company. Throughout his career, Little has focused on municipal issues such as housing affordability, transportation, and infrastructure management, including advocating for public inquiries into regional project costs. He is a lifelong resident of North Vancouver and holds a degree in political science from Trinity Western University.
